NextGen offers a unique opportunity for aspiring Maryland, Virginia, and Washington, DC-area artists (ages 17-27) with little or no exhibition experience to show their work in a professional gallery and participate in related programming, including an opening celebration and artist talks, conversations with other emerging artists, critiques with local curators and arts administrators who work with young artists, and additional professional development opportunities.
This year’s exhibition, NextGen 12.0, will be presented in the Kaplan Gallery from May 30–July 20, 2025.
The jurors for this year’s show were Alex Ebstein, an artist, independent curator, and senior program manager for the Robert W. Deutsch Foundation, and Anisa Olufemi M., an artist, curator, and director of programs for Hamiltonian Artists.
